How to Use This Template¶
- Understand Requirements: Thoroughly review the requirement or user story being tested
- Design Test Scenario: Identify the specific condition or workflow to validate
- Document Steps: Write clear, step-by-step instructions anyone can follow
- Define Expected Results: Specify measurable, unambiguous expected outcomes
- Review: Have test cases peer-reviewed before execution
- Maintain: Update test cases when requirements or application behavior changes
Tips for Writing Effective Test Cases¶
- Be Specific: Provide exact values, not "enter some text"
- Be Atomic: Test one thing at a time for easier debugging
- Be Complete: Include setup, execution, and cleanup steps
- Be Clear: Anyone should be able to execute without asking questions
- Include Both Positive and Negative Scenarios: Test both expected use and error conditions

Priority¶
Selection Guide: - High: Critical functionality, frequently used features, high-risk areas, must test before release - Medium: Important features, moderate usage, should test in each cycle - Low: Nice-to-have features, rarely used functionality, can defer if time constrained
- High
- Medium
- Low
Test Type¶
Selection Guide: Choose all applicable types. A single test case can belong to multiple types.
- Functional - Validates feature meets functional requirements
- Integration - Tests interaction between components or systems
- Regression - Ensures existing functionality still works after changes
- Smoke - Quick validation of critical functionality
- Sanity - Focused check after specific changes
- Performance - Validates speed, scalability, or resource usage
- Security - Tests for vulnerabilities or access control
- Usability - Evaluates user experience and ease of use
- Other: [Specify]
Test Method¶
Selection Guide: - Manual: Best for exploratory, usability, visual validation, one-time tests - Automated: Best for repetitive tests, regression suites, API testing, performance testing - Semi-Automated: Combination of both (e.g., automated setup, manual validation)
- Manual
- Automated
- Semi-Automated

Test Steps¶
Purpose: Provides step-by-step instructions for executing the test case.
Instructions: - Action: What to do (e.g., "Click Login button", "Enter 'admin' in Username field") - Expected Result: What should happen (e.g., "User is redirected to dashboard", "Error message displays") - Actual Result: Leave blank until execution; document what actually happened - Status: Mark as Pass/Fail/Blocked after execution - Comments: Note any observations, deviations, or additional context
Tips for Writing Steps: - Number steps sequentially - Be explicit and detailed - Use active voice - Include specific values and locations - One action per step when possible
| Step # | Action | Expected Result | Actual Result | Status | Comments |
|---|---|---|---|---|---|
| 1 | [Navigate to login page at https://app.example.com/login] | [Login page displays with username, password fields and login button] | |||
| 2 | [Enter 'testuser@example.com' in Username field] | [Text appears in username field] | |||
| 3 | [Enter 'Test@1234' in Password field] | [Password is masked with dots] | |||
| 4 | [Click 'Login' button] | [User is redirected to dashboard, welcome message displays] |

Execution Status¶
Status Definitions: - Not Executed: Test case has not been run yet - In Progress: Currently being executed - Pass: All steps passed, expected results matched actual results - Fail: One or more steps failed, defect should be logged - Blocked: Cannot execute due to blocker (environment issue, prerequisite failure, missing data) - Deferred: Postponed to future cycle
- Not Executed
- In Progress
- Pass
- Fail
- Blocked
- Deferred

Instructions for Using This Template¶
Creating a New Test Case¶
- Test Case ID: Use a consistent naming convention (e.g., TC-[MODULE]-[###])
- TC-LOGIN-001, TC-LOGIN-002 for login module
- TC-CART-001, TC-CART-002 for shopping cart
- Test Case Title: Should be clear and descriptive
- Good: "Verify successful login with valid credentials"
- Poor: "Login test"
- Test Objective: Explain what you're validating in one sentence
- Test Steps: Be specific and detailed enough that anyone can execute
- Expected Results: Should be clear and measurable, not vague
- Good: "User is redirected to dashboard page (URL: /dashboard)"
- Poor: "User is redirected"
Executing a Test Case¶
- Review preconditions and ensure they are met
- Gather required test data
- Follow test steps exactly as written
- Document actual results for each step
- Mark status (Pass/Fail/Blocked)
- Take screenshots or evidence
- Log defects for any failures
- Update defects section with defect references
Maintaining Test Cases¶
- Review and update when requirements change
- Update after application changes that affect the test
- Refine based on feedback from test execution
- Archive or remove obsolete test cases
- Version control test case updates
- Document significant changes in Notes section
Best Practices¶
Writing Test Cases¶
- Keep test cases atomic: Test one thing at a time for easier debugging
- Make steps clear and unambiguous: Anyone should understand without explanation
- Include both positive and negative scenarios: Test expected use and error conditions
- Be specific with data: Use actual values, not "enter some text"
- Consider edge cases: Boundary values, null values, special characters
- Make test cases reusable: Design for multiple test cycles
Reviewing Test Cases¶
- Verify test cases before execution
- Check for completeness and clarity
- Ensure traceability to requirements
- Validate expected results are measurable
- Confirm test data is realistic
Managing Test Cases¶
- Update test cases when requirements change
- Maintain version history
- Use consistent naming conventions
- Organize test cases logically (by module, feature, priority)
- Regular cleanup of obsolete test cases
